There is a good support structure here in Chicago as well as you guys on the board, so when I come across issues like CHF power steering (due to LAD rear suspn) being compatible with the ATF pump on the M30, I am confident that a solution is available. In this case, a qualified independent who is in the middle of a similar conversion, told me that the ATF p/s pump on the M30 will work with the CHF used on the touring.

dual pump with 2 pumps in one body one behind the other. If your going to have self leveling still you'll need to use that tandem pump instead of the m30 pump.
